When Should You Rent a Scissor Lift Versus a Boom Lift in Victoria, TX?

Scissor lifts and boom lifts both provide elevated work platforms, but they differ in reach, maneuverability, and terrain capability. In Victoria, TX, selecting the right aerial platform depends on your project's height requirements, obstacles, and ground conditions.

How Do Scissor Lifts and Boom Lifts Differ in Function?

Scissor lifts move straight up and down, while boom lifts extend horizontally and vertically to reach over obstacles and access difficult angles.

Scissor lifts use a crisscross mechanism to raise the platform vertically. This design provides a stable, spacious work area ideal for tasks that require multiple workers or materials at height, such as ceiling installation, HVAC work, or warehouse maintenance.

Boom lifts feature an articulating or telescoping arm that extends outward and upward. This flexibility allows operators to position the platform over walls, around equipment, or beside structures without moving the base, making them essential for exterior building work, tree trimming, and utility repairs.

Electric scissor lifts operate quietly indoors on smooth, level surfaces like concrete or tile. Rough-terrain scissor lifts with larger tires and higher ground clearance handle outdoor sites with gravel, dirt, or mild slopes.

Boom lifts come in two main types: articulating booms with multiple joints for navigating tight spaces, and telescopic booms with a single extending arm for maximum reach. Both types are available in electric or diesel models depending on the work environment.

Which Projects Require Scissor Lifts?

Scissor lifts excel in applications where vertical reach and a large platform area matter more than horizontal extension or obstacle clearance.

Interior construction and renovation projects benefit from electric scissor lifts, which produce zero emissions and fit through standard doorways. Tasks like drywall installation, painting, and electrical work proceed faster when workers can move freely on a stable platform without repositioning the machine frequently.

Warehouse and retail environments use scissor lifts for inventory management, lighting maintenance, and signage installation. The platform's guardrails and ample space allow workers to carry tools and materials safely, reducing trips up and down ladders.

Outdoor events and facility maintenance often call for rough-terrain scissor lifts. These models navigate grass, gravel, and uneven pavement while providing the vertical reach needed for tent setup, banner hanging, and exterior lighting adjustments.

Scissor lifts typically reach heights between 20 and 40 feet, with platform capacities ranging from 500 to 1,500 pounds. This combination of height and load capacity supports most tasks that occur directly above the machine's footprint.

When Do Boom Lifts Become Necessary?

Boom lifts solve access challenges that scissor lifts cannot, particularly when obstacles block vertical paths or work areas lie beyond the machine's base.

Building exteriors require boom lifts for tasks like window washing, facade repair, and roofline inspection. The articulating arm extends over landscaping, parked vehicles, or ground-level equipment, allowing workers to reach upper floors without moving obstructions.

Tree care and vegetation management depend on boom lifts to position arborists safely among branches. The platform's ability to rotate and extend in multiple directions provides precise control for pruning, cabling, and removal work.

Utility and telecommunications projects use boom lifts to access power lines, transformers, and cell towers. Telescopic booms reach heights exceeding 100 feet, while articulating models navigate around existing infrastructure without requiring road closures or extensive site prep.

Boom lifts also serve construction sites with uneven terrain or limited ground access. Four-wheel drive and oscillating axles keep the machine stable on slopes and rough ground, while the extended reach eliminates the need to reposition frequently.

How Does Terrain in Victoria, TX Influence Equipment Choice?

Victoria's mix of urban development and rural sites presents varied ground conditions that affect aerial platform performance and safety.

Paved surfaces in commercial districts and industrial parks suit electric scissor lifts, which offer quiet operation and zero emissions. These machines work well indoors or on smooth outdoor concrete, where their narrow wheelbases and tight turning radii simplify navigation in confined spaces.

Construction sites with dirt, gravel, or mud require rough-terrain models. Scissor lifts with larger tires and higher ground clearance handle moderate slopes and uneven surfaces, while boom lifts with four-wheel drive and oscillating axles maintain stability on steeper grades and softer ground.

Wet conditions during Victoria's rainy season reduce traction and increase the risk of sinking or sliding. Machines with wider tires or tracks distribute weight more evenly, preventing ruts and maintaining control on saturated soil.

Overhead clearance also matters. Indoor projects with low ceilings or tight doorways limit scissor lift height, while outdoor sites with power lines or tree canopies require careful planning to avoid contact with the boom during extension and retraction.

What Safety Considerations Apply to Each Type?

Operator training, load limits, and environmental factors all influence safe operation of scissor lifts and boom lifts.

Scissor lifts demand attention to platform capacity. Overloading the platform with workers, tools, or materials can cause the machine to tip or fail, especially when extended to maximum height. Always verify the manufacturer's weight rating and distribute loads evenly across the platform.

Boom lifts require operators to monitor swing radius and clearance. The extended arm can strike structures, vehicles, or power lines if the operator misjudges distance or fails to account for wind sway. Establish exclusion zones around the machine and use spotters when working near obstacles.

Wind speed affects both machine types but poses greater risk to boom lifts due to their extended reach and smaller platform area. Most manufacturers recommend ceasing operation when wind speeds exceed 28 miles per hour, as gusts can destabilize the platform or cause sudden movements.

Ground conditions must be assessed before positioning either machine. Soft soil, slopes exceeding the manufacturer's rating, or unstable surfaces increase the risk of tipping. Use outriggers or stabilizers when available, and avoid driving with the platform elevated unless the machine is rated for such use.

Can You Switch Between Scissor and Boom Lifts Mid-Project?

Changing equipment types during a project is possible but requires planning to avoid delays and additional costs.

If your initial equipment choice proves inadequate—such as a scissor lift that cannot reach over a parapet wall—contact your rental provider to arrange a swap. Most companies in Victoria, TX offer flexible terms that allow equipment exchanges with minimal downtime.

Switching from a boom lift to a scissor lift may occur when site conditions improve or when the project phase shifts from exterior to interior work. Electric scissor lifts cost less per day than boom lifts, so transitioning to a scissor lift for finishing tasks can reduce overall rental expenses.

Combining both machine types on larger projects increases efficiency. Assigning a scissor lift to interior tasks while a boom lift handles exterior work allows crews to progress simultaneously, shortening the project timeline and reducing labor costs.

Advance notice improves availability and delivery scheduling. Inform your rental provider of potential equipment changes as early as possible to ensure the replacement machine arrives when needed, preventing idle crew time.

How Do Rental Rates Compare Between Scissor and Boom Lifts?

Daily, weekly, and monthly rates vary based on machine size, power source, and terrain capability, with boom lifts generally costing more due to their complexity and reach.

Electric scissor lifts typically rent for less than diesel or rough-terrain models. Their simpler design and lower maintenance requirements translate to lower daily rates, making them cost-effective for short-term indoor projects.

Boom lifts command higher rates because of their extended reach, articulating arms, and four-wheel drive systems. Telescopic booms with heights exceeding 80 feet cost more than articulating models with shorter reach, reflecting the specialized engineering and transport requirements.

Weekly and monthly rates offer better value for extended projects. If your job spans more than a few days, negotiating a weekly rate reduces the per-day cost and locks in availability, preventing the need to return and re-rent the same machine.

Delivery fees depend on distance and equipment size. Renting from a provider near your Victoria, TX job site minimizes transport charges and allows for quicker equipment swaps or service calls if issues arise during the rental period.
